58762
50640
50640Z
58010
58010Z
58225A

BODY(R),FRONT DOOR

Part number: DKY0-58-02XD

Price: USD 316.00 /Unit

Brand: Mazda

Add to cart
Add to Watchlist

Related parts

Details

Features & Benefits